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Kettering to King's College London is to drive which costs £18 - £27 and takes 1h 43m.
The fastest way to get from Kettering to King's College London is to train which takes 1h 23m and costs £35 - £65.
No, there is no direct train from Kettering to King's College London. However, there are services departing from Kettering and arriving at London St Pancras Intl via . The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 23m.
The distance between Kettering and King's College London is 74 miles. The road distance is 76.6 miles.
The best way to get from Kettering to King's College London without a car is to train which takes 1h 23m and costs £35 - £65.
It takes approximately 1h 23m to get from Kettering to King's College London, including transfers.
Kettering to King's College London train services, operated by Thameslink, depart from Bedford station.
Kettering to King's College London train services, operated by Thameslink, arrive at London Blackfriars station.
Yes, the driving distance between Kettering to King's College London is 77 miles. It takes approximately 1h 43m to drive from Kettering to King's College London.

What companies run services between Kettering, England and King's College London, England?
East Midlands Railways operates a train from Kettering to London St Pancras Intl every 20 minutes. Tickets cost £35–55 and the journey takes 1h 3m.
